Why a USB Stick for an Android Phone Is Necessary

I find a USB stick for my Android phone really useful because it gives me extra storage whenever my phone starts getting full. Instead of deleting photos, videos, or important files, I can move them to the USB stick and keep my phone running smoothly. It also helps me save space for new apps and updates without worrying about storage warnings.

My favorite reason is how easy it is to transfer files. I can quickly move documents, pictures, or videos between my phone and other devices without using the internet or cloud storage. This is especially helpful when I need to share large files fast or keep a backup of important data.

I also like that a USB stick gives me more control over my files. My data stays with me, and I do not have to depend only on online storage services. For me, it is a simple, practical, and reliable way to keep my Android phone organized and ready for everyday use.

My Buying Guides on Usb Stick For Android Phone

1. What I Look For First: Compatibility

When I buy a USB stick for my Android phone, the first thing I check is whether it supports my phone’s port. Most Android phones today use USB-C, but some older models still use micro-USB. I always make sure the stick matches my phone type or comes with an adapter that works properly.

2. Storage Capacity That Fits My Needs

I think about how I plan to use the USB stick before choosing a size. If I only need it for photos, documents, or a few videos, a smaller capacity may be enough. But if I want to back up large files, movies, or lots of apps and media, I prefer a bigger storage option. For me, it is better to buy a little more space than I think I need.

3. Transfer Speed Matters to Me

I always pay attention to transfer speed because it saves me time. A USB stick with faster read and write speeds makes moving files between my phone and other devices much easier. If I often transfer large videos or many photos, I look for USB 3.0, USB 3.1, or USB-C models for better performance.

4. Build Quality and Durability

I like a USB stick that feels strong and reliable. Since I carry mine in a bag or pocket, I prefer one with a sturdy body, a protective cap, or even a swivel design. If I expect to use it often, I choose one that can handle daily wear and tear without breaking easily.

5. File System Support

I make sure the USB stick works well with Android file management. Some drives may need to be formatted in a way that Android can read easily, such as exFAT or FAT32. I check this before buying because I do not want to face issues when trying to open or save files.

6. OTG Support

For me, OTG support is essential. USB On-The-Go allows my Android phone to connect directly to the USB stick. I always confirm that my phone supports OTG and that the USB stick is designed for phone use. Without this, the drive may not work the way I expect.

7. Brand Reputation and Reliability

I trust brands that are known for making dependable storage devices. A well-known brand usually gives me more confidence in the product’s quality and lifespan. I also like checking reviews from other buyers to see if the USB stick performs well over time.

8. Portability and Design

I prefer a USB stick that is easy to carry and simple to use. A compact design is helpful when I want to keep it in my pocket or attach it to my keychain. If the drive has both USB-A and USB-C connectors, I find it even more convenient for use with different devices.

9. Security Features I Appreciate

If I plan to store personal files, I look for extra security features. Some USB sticks offer password protection or encryption, which gives me peace of mind. I feel better knowing my private photos, documents, or work files are more protected.

10. Price vs. Value

I do not always choose the cheapest option. Instead, I look for the best value for my money. A slightly more expensive USB stick with better speed, durability, and compatibility is often worth it to me. I try to balance price with features so I get a product that lasts.
